How to Verify Gold Suppliers in Africa Before Payment (Avoid Scams)

Dealing with mineral suppliers in Africa can be lucrative , but it also presents risks of deceptive practices. To shield yourself from risking your money , it’s critically important to meticulously verify their authenticity before making any remittance . Begin by requesting verifiable documentation , such as a valid mining authorization from the relevant African nation agency . Cross-reference this information with the issuing body directly – don't just trust what the supplier gives. In addition, conduct a background check on the company, reviewing for any previous complaints or legal actions. Finally, consider an third-party consultant to directly view the operation and validate the quality of the precious metal offered.

Navigating African Gold Markets: A Buyer's Guide to Safety and Compliance

Venturing into the African gold sector presents significant opportunities, but requires thorough navigation to ensure both security and complete compliance. Understanding the governmental landscape is absolutely important. This includes investigating the particular mining permits of the supplier and confirming their conformity to local rules regarding environmental practices and workforce standards. Buyers should invariably perform due diligence , verifying supply of origin and avoiding potential dangers . Here are key points to evaluate :

  • Confirm the seller's credentials and history.
  • Ensure visibility of the gold via the source.
  • Comply with applicable international financial crime washing guidelines .
  • Seek third-party verification of the gold's purity .

Finally, establishing strong relationships with well-regarded regional experts can provide invaluable insight throughout the procurement process.
